About This Item

Christian World Imprint. Hardcover. New. The book is a special endeavor for readers to reread the Biblical Texts entirely from non-traditional Ecological perspectives and motivate them to join hands with the people who have genuine concern for the Creation. The Author has tried to show linkage between Colonialism and Environmental damage, he further proposes for the review of inherited mindset of Indian Christians that has become indifferent towards the Ecological Problems.He proposes a complete review for its deconstruction and replacement with a sound Biblical and Theological Methodology.
